Lismore Farm | Swellendam, Western Cape

The Lismore Farm is old and established, having been in the Barry family since 1844. The farm has an illustrious history and when you’re visitingĀ  it can be riveting listening to how it was once used as a horse breeding farm for the Dutch East India Company and other interesting facts.
